Factors Influencing Weight Capacity of Plywood Shelves

When considering the weight limit for 3/4 inch plywood shelves, various factors come into play. One key aspect is the type of plywood used. Different densities and compositions can significantly alter the weight capacity of the shelf. For instance, a higher-grade plywood may hold more weight than a lower-grade option. Understanding these differences can make a big impact on shelf performance.

Another factor is the span of the shelf. The longer the distance between the supports, the more likely the shelf will sag under weight. A shelf with a shorter span will distribute the weight more evenly. Furthermore, how the shelf is installed also matters. Proper brackets and reinforcement can enhance the weight capacity. In some cases, users might not realize that inadequate support will compromise the shelf, leading to risks and potential damage.

Lastly, the weight distribution on the shelf is crucial. Placing heavy items in the center can create a focal point of stress. Conversely, spreading the load evenly can help mitigate sagging. Industry Standards for Weight Limits on Plywood Shelving Units

When it comes to plywood shelving units, understanding the weight limit is crucial. The weight that 3/4-inch plywood can support varies based on several factors. These factors include span length, support placement, and the type of load. Typically, 3/4-inch plywood shelves can hold between 30 to 50 pounds per linear foot, depending on the specific design.

Industry standards emphasize the importance of proper reinforcement. Shelves longer than 36 inches need additional support, such as brackets or a middle support beam. The distribution of weight also plays a significant role in performance. Unevenly distributed loads can lead to bending or even breaking. It’s advisable to avoid placing heavy items in the center of a shelf without support.
